Mastery React Native: Build A Dynamic Music Player App

Posted By: ELK1nG

Mastery React Native: Build A Dynamic Music Player App
Published 5/2024
MP4 | Video: h264, 1920x1080 | Audio: AAC, 44.1 KHz
Language: English | Size: 8.89 GB | Duration: 8h 28m

Unlock React Native Proficiency, Create Stunning UIs, Implement Advanced Features, Mastery React Native Track Player

What you'll learn

Mastery of React Native by developing a fully functional music player application with theme integration.

Implementation of advanced features such as player controls, dynamic data binding, and theme customization.

Understanding of React Native concepts and best practices through hands-on project-based learning.

Proficiency in building scalable and robust mobile applications using React Native.

Requirements

Basic knowledge of JavaScript and React concepts.

Familiarity with mobile app development concepts would be beneficial but not required.

Access to a computer with internet connectivity for downloading necessary software and tools.

A willingness to learn and experiment with React Native development.

Description

Embark on a transformative learning journey where theory seamlessly integrates with practice, empowering you to translate concepts into impactful solutions. This immersive course goes beyond traditional learning approaches, offering a dynamic blend of theoretical insights and practical applications through hands-on projects and exercises.Discover the art of crafting robust, high-performance mobile applications that captivate users with React Native, as you:- Gain a comprehensive understanding of React Native's foundational concepts, including its component-based architecture, state management solutions, and advanced navigation techniques.- Explore a myriad of libraries, tools, and features integral to React Native development, such as Redux for state management, React Navigation for navigation solutions, and AsyncStorage for local data persistence.- Learn to integrate third-party libraries for enhanced functionality, leverage React Native's powerful UI components for visually stunning designs, and implement advanced features like animations and gestures.- Dive into practical application, experimenting with various techniques and methodologies to refine your skills and expand your development toolkit.- By the course's conclusion, emerge as a proficient React Native developer, equipped with the knowledge, skills, and confidence to tackle real-world projects with finesse.Join us on this transformative learning experience and unlock the full potential of React Native as you embark on a journey towards mastery in mobile app development.

Overview

Section 1: Introduction and Music Player Application Demonstration

Lecture 1 Introduction And App Demo

Section 2: Initial Setup and Navigation

Lecture 2 Project Initialization and Stack Navigation

Lecture 3 Stack Navigation Setup

Section 3: Designing the Home Screen

Lecture 4 Crafting a Captivating Home Screen And Creating The Color Constants

Lecture 5 Implementing React Native Vectors Setup

Lecture 6 Header Component

Lecture 7 Font Family Setup And Creating The Constants Of Font Size

Section 4: Advanced Navigation (Drawer Navigation) Setup and Design The Floating Player

Lecture 8 Home Screen Design Continued

Lecture 9 Floating Player Design

Section 5: Designing The Floating Player

Lecture 10 Floating Player Slider And React Native Gesture Handler and Reanimated Setup

Lecture 11 Moving Animated Text on Floating Player Like Real Worlds Apps

Section 6: Exploring Additional Features and Design Music Player Screen

Lecture 12 Like Songs and State Management with AsyncStorage

Lecture 13 Music Player Screen Header Component Designing

Lecture 14 Music Player Screen Title And Cover Image UI

Lecture 15 Player Screen Continued

Section 7: Conclusion and Next Steps

Lecture 16 Custom Drawer Navigation

Lecture 17 Creating Sample Data for App Continued

Lecture 18 Data Mapping on Home Screen Continued

Lecture 19 Track Player Setup and Play Single Song Continued

Lecture 20 React Native Track Player Play Song in Queue Continued

Lecture 21 Use Setup Player and Remote Service React Native Track Player Continued

Lecture 22 Player Screen Data Binding

Lecture 23 Player Repeat Mode, Shuffle, Progress Bar, and Duration Text

Section 8: Additional Features and Testing

Lecture 24 Like Songs, AsyncStorage, and Zustand

Lecture 25 Light Theme and Dark Theme App Testing

JavaScript developers interested in mastering React Native for mobile app development.,React developers looking to expand their skills into mobile app development.,Students and professionals seeking practical experience in building real-world applications with React Native.,Anyone passionate about music and mobile app development, eager to create their own music player app.